To the guys shooting the 180 Bergers**

...7LRM is pushing those bullets 3050-3100 by the looks of these posts, has anybody noticed any odd number of your bullets dusting/disintegrating mid-air, by chance? Are they built and chambered into barrels with 1:9 twists, or 8.5 twist, or what exactly??

I've got a little different caliber than the LRM, but velocities were similar to where ( I ) ran into some troubles.. curious whether you guys putting lots of rounds through your LRM's have noted bullet-failures of any kind? (Or has the twist the Gunwerks guys are building around been okay on the bullet jackets) ??
 
My 7 LRM is built on a 1 in 9 twist. I have shot a little over 500 rounds (536 to be exact) in the last year and have never seen a bullet failure like you are describing. I saw your other post where you described it in detail. I have also shot about that same amount of 140 g Bergers out of a 6.5x284 with no issues.
 
Rooster 721:

Regarding your unraveling bullets. I used to have a 3 groove 1 in 7 twist 7 Rem mag that began throwing 180 VLDs at round count 225 or so. I switched to the target versions which helped for another 50 rounds or so. Then tried moly which again helped for a little while. The combination of the 3 groove throat getting rough plus the faster than normal twist would ruin the Bergers causing flyers that would be several feet off normal POI at 100 yds! Accubonds solved the issue but the BC suffered. I moved on and learned to more carefully consider the combination of twist and groove configuration with barrels after that expensive mistake.

AZ, you're probably onto something there. I figured I'd get away from that by having 5R groove design, regardless of being 8 twist.. but wasn't so lucky. And relating to round count, there too you nailed it. Mine is in that 440 range right now and even the target hybrids can't hold up... which is odd, because I've babied the barrel with cleanings and short shot strings.

Point of me bringing this twist-issue/bullet failure thing up is to settle on the twist for the next barrel coming down the line... I've settled for a lesser BC Barnes LRX (which is still an awesome bullet by the way) just sufferes a .550 bc rather than that of the Berger or Matrix's. Anyhow, appreciate the replies*

On another note, I see Gunwerks has LRX loaded ammo offered now for the 7LRM.. have any of you guys shot any of those and chronographed what they're giving for speeds? My firebird shoots them 3200 and .6's for groups in the barrel I been talking about the last few posts. Fortunate my barrel likes (them) so much, pretty well forced to stay away from Berger's til I rebarrel really. Very interested in the 7LRM's performance with the 168 Barnes'

Just adding my load data to an old thread for those who may be searching for 7LRM loads.
My gun: Blueprinted/tried Remington 700 action, Proof Reseaech 26" sendero light Carbon barrel.
Load:
180 Berger Hybrid
70.5 grns H1000
Fed 215 primes
Coal 3.403
Ogive 2.682
3020fps

3 shot group at 200 yards with above load.
